A project manager is working on a proposal for a new project and is currently focusing on the cost estimate.
A high-level overall estimate.
In project management, a cost estimate at a high level provides a broad overview of the expected costs associated with the entire project, allowing for initial planning and budget allocation before delving into more detailed estimates.
This choice focuses specifically on the material costs, which are essential but represent only a portion of the overall project costs. A precise estimate for materials is more detailed and comes after the high-level estimate has been established.
This option accurately reflects the initial phase of project cost estimation, where the project manager assesses the total expected costs without getting into the specifics of materials, resources, or components. It serves as a foundational guideline for budget discussions and project feasibility.
Like the material estimate, this choice targets a specific aspect of project costs—resources such as labor and equipment. While important, it does not capture the overall financial picture required at the proposal stage, which necessitates a broader view.
This choice implies a level of detail that is not suitable at the proposal stage. Estimating costs for each component is a subsequent step that follows the initial high-level estimate, which sets the context for understanding the overall budget.
In the early stages of project management, particularly when preparing a proposal, a high-level overall estimate is crucial for guiding initial budgeting and resource allocation. It encompasses a comprehensive view of project costs, while more detailed estimates for materials, resources, or components can be developed later as the project plan solidifies. This approach ensures that the project manager remains aligned with the overall financial objectives of the project.
